The considerations I will take when I am taking my
photographs will be not using a flash because it will scare the animals
away, to avoid this I will need to change the sensitivity of the camera towards
the light meaning to change the aperture to a wide setting. this will let in more light
and also I would change the shutter speed to be very fast to ovoid blur because the animals
will most probably be moving. I will also take into account that the weather
might be raining so I will need to bring a cover for the camera.
The ISO I will change to 200 or 100 for weather conditions and the mode I will be using is landscape and portrait with no flash.
